> Setup: Advanced Networking Zone, Nexus 1000v VMWARE cluster , CISCO VNMC as PF/Static Nat/Source Nat/Firewall provider 
> Observation:
> 1. Created Network Offering with  CISCO VNMC as PF/Static Nat/Source Nat/Firewall provider 
> 2. Create Guest Network with above offering and deploy instance using this network
> 3. Configure PF rule with 22 TCP port and add above deployed VM
> 4. Access VNMC and verify the ACL's created @ policy Management dash board with this VLAN tenant. 
> Observation :
> 1.There is an ACL with Source as any Destination as the VM with specific port. 
> 2. With the current implementation of CISCO ASA firewall , we allow all the incoming traffic with the specific ports being open thru PF/Static NAT
> 3. There is no way to block incoming traffic as ACL created with PF/Static Nat is Source is Any .
